Product Manager (EMS – Hospitality SaaS)

Salary: £55,000 – £70,000

Location: UK – Fully Remote

Company Overview

Our client is a fast-growing SaaS provider within the hospitality space, helping hotels and resorts increase revenue and guest satisfaction through seamless digital experiences.

Their platform enables guests to browse and book onsite experiences such as spa treatments, golf, memberships, and activities all with real-time availability, integrated payments, and a unified booking journey.

Role Overview

We’re looking for a Product Manager who thrives at the intersection of Product Ownership and Business Analysis. Reporting directly to the Senior Product Leadership, you’ll work closely with engineering, design, and commercial teams to translate customer needs and business requirements into well-defined user stories, detailed specifications, and clear delivery priorities.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ys being hands-on in delivery, managing backlogs, and ensuring every release delivers measurable value to users. The Experience Management System (EMS) is a B2B2C product, connecting hotel operations with guests through intuitive, real-time booking and management tools.

Product Manager (EMS – Hospitality SaaS) - Key Responsibilities

Own and manage the backlog for the Experience Management System (EMS), ensuring stories are well-defined, prioritised, and aligned with business objectives.
Collaborate with stakeholders across customer success, engineering, and commercial teams to gather and refine product requirements.
Translate complex requirements into detailed user stories and acceptance criteria to support sprint planning and delivery.
Work with design and engineering to ensure user flows and feature specifications are fully understood before development begins.
Act as the product expert within delivery teams, clarifying priorities and providing quick feedback during sprints.
Support integrations with PMS and other third-party systems to enhance functionality and automation.
Review completed work to confirm alignment with requirements and user expectations.
Monitor and analyse product usage data, gathering feedback to inform continuous improvement and backlog refinement.
Contribute to release planning and documentation to ensure smooth communication with internal teams and customers.

Product Manager (EMS – Hospitality SaaS) - Requirements

Proven experience as a Product Owner, Product Manager, or Business Analyst within a SaaS or technology environment.
Background in Hotel Software or Hospitality Technology is essential.
Experience with payments or payment integrations is highly advantageous.
Strong understanding of Agile delivery, sprint planning, backlog refinement, and user story creation.
Ability to translate customer and business needs into clear, actionable requirements.
Experience collaborating with cross-functional teams (engineering, design, customer success).
Familiarity with PMS integrations, booking logic, or real-time availability systems is a plus.
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ills, with a keen eye for detail.
Analytical mindset with the ability to interpret data and prioritise effectively based on impact.
